LSU quarterback Sam Leavitt doubtful, Landen Clark could start against Ole Miss
Summary

LSU's starting quarterback Sam Leavitt is listed as doubtful for the Week 3 matchup against Ole Miss on September 19. Backup Landen Clark, who has played in both games this season, may make his first start. Clark has recorded 109 passing yards and one touchdown, along with 42 rushing yards and another touchdown. The game also marks former Ole Miss coach Lane Kiffin's return to Vaught-Hemingway Stadium. Husan Longstreet, officially listed as a backup, may also be in contention for the start, though Clark has primarily filled that role this season.
